99久久99久久精品免观看,国产精品久久久久国产精品,国产黄色录像视频,免费的黄色毛片,国产一区精品普通话对白,色妞妞成人在线观看,最新aⅴ福利在线观看免费

綠色資源網(wǎng):您身邊最放心的安全下載站! 最新軟件|熱門排行|軟件分類|軟件專題|廠商大全

綠色資源網(wǎng)

技術(shù)教程
您的位置:首頁(yè)網(wǎng)頁(yè)設(shè)計(jì)HTML/CSS → CSS代碼解決網(wǎng)頁(yè)掛馬問(wèn)題

CSS代碼解決網(wǎng)頁(yè)掛馬問(wèn)題

我要評(píng)論 2009/09/30 09:28:45 來(lái)源:綠色資源網(wǎng) 編輯:佚名 [ ] 評(píng)論:0 點(diǎn)擊:308次

兩行CSS來(lái)解決,共5種方案

一、

iframe{n1ifm:expression(this.src=‘about:blank’,this.outerHTML=‘’);}/*這行代碼是解決掛IFRAME木馬的哦*/

script{nojs1: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.write(‘木馬被成功隔離!’):‘’);}

原理:將《script》標(biāo)記的src拿出來(lái)轉(zhuǎn)為小寫(xiě),再看是不是以“http”開(kāi)頭的外域JS腳本文件,如果是,則頁(yè)面內(nèi)容清空并寫(xiě)出“木馬被成功隔離!”。反之正常顯示。 缺點(diǎn):訪客無(wú)法看到被感染了《script》木馬的頁(yè)面。

二、

iframe{nifm2: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{no2js: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.close():‘’);}

原理:將外域的JS文件的document.write()使用document.close()強(qiáng)制關(guān)閉。木馬內(nèi)容還沒(méi)有來(lái)得及寫(xiě)完,只有部分被強(qiáng)制緩存輸出了,剩下的不會(huì)再寫(xiě)了。

三、

iframe{ni3fm: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{n3ojs:expression((this.src.toLowerCase().indexOf(‘http’)==0)?document.execCommand(‘stop’):‘’);}

原理:同到外域的JS文件,立即調(diào)用IE私有的execCommand方法來(lái)停止頁(yè)面所有請(qǐng)求,所以接下來(lái)的外域JS文件也被強(qiáng)制停止下載了。就像我們點(diǎn)了瀏覽器的“停止”按鈕一樣。看來(lái)這是JS模擬IE停止按鈕的一種方法。

四、

iframe{nif4m: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{noj4s:expression(if(this.src.indexOf(‘http’)==0)this.src=‘res://ieframe.dll/dnserror.htm’);}

原理:將外域的JS文件的src重寫(xiě)成本地IE404錯(cuò)誤頁(yè)面的地址,這樣,外域的JS代碼不會(huì)下載。

五、

iframe{nifm5:expression(this.src=‘about:blank’,this.outerHTML=‘’);}

script{noj5s:expression((this.id.toLowerCase().indexOf(‘vok’)!=-1)?document.write(‘木馬被成功隔離!’):‘’));}

第五種方案的頁(yè)面HTML源代碼《script》中要加入以“lh”為前綴的id,如lhWeatherJSapi,《script src=“***/**.js” id=“lhSearchJSapi”》《/script》

關(guān)鍵詞:CSS,網(wǎng)頁(yè)掛馬

閱讀本文后您有什么感想? 已有 人給出評(píng)價(jià)!

  • 0 歡迎喜歡
  • 0 白癡
  • 0 拜托
  • 0 哇
  • 0 加油
  • 0 鄙視